Amherstia nobilis, also known as the Pride of Burma is a tropical tree with large, showy flowers. Considered "The World's Most Beautiful Flowering Tree" and one of the rarest! A small to moderate sized "Royal Poinciana" relative with dangling chains of salmon-scarlet blooms with orange and yellow lips in late winter. New "weeping" growth hangs like burgundy handkerchiefs.

South Florida is the only locale in the continental U.S. where this tree can grow outside. Choose a sheltered site out of cold NE winter winds. Best in part to full sun and routine irrigation.
